In South Prairie, the damp Pacific Northwest climate is the single biggest factor in how long a roof lasts. Persistent rain and shade keep roofs in South Prairie damp, and moss and algae take hold quickly on north-facing slopes, lifting shingles and trapping moisture against the deck. With most South Prairie homes built around 1983, a typical roof in town is roughly 43 years old — prime territory for granule loss, leaks, and full replacement.

Most Common Roofing Issues in South Prairie

Age-related shingle failure

Many South Prairie homes were built around 1983, so roofs here are commonly 43+ years old — near or past the 20–30 year lifespan of asphalt shingles, when curling, granule loss, and leaks set in.

Moss, algae, and trapped moisture

Humidity and frequent rain around South Prairie encourage moss and algae growth and trap moisture, which degrades shingles and decking over time.

Roofing Through the Year in South Prairie

SeasonWhat it means for your roof
SpringInspect for any winter wear and clear debris from valleys and gutters.
SummerWarm, dry conditions make this the best season for repairs and replacements.
FallSchedule maintenance and gutter cleaning ahead of the wet season.
WinterWet, windy weather — watch for leaks; plan major work for drier months.
